Desired Qualifications:

  • Active California Speech-Language Pathology license (or eligibility)
  • Certificate of Clinical Competence (CCC) or Clinical Fellowship Year (CFY) welcomed
  • Experience or strong interest in school-based settings
  • Excellent communication, organization, and teamwork skills
  • Familiarity with IEP processes and service documentation

Key Responsibilities:

  • Provide direct speech and language therapy services to students in compliance with IEPs
  • Conduct comprehensive assessments and participate in the development of IEPs with multidisciplinary teams
  • Collaborate closely with teachers, parents, and support staff to design and implement individualized communication strategies
  • Maintain accurate records, timely documentation, and progress monitoring to support student success
